SpaceX shares jump 19% after $75bn IPO

Elon Musk's SpaceX has just made the biggest initial public offering in history, raising a record $75 billion for its ambitious plans. Shares started trading on the Nasdaq Stock Exchange on Friday, opening at $150 after strong investor interest. The stock then closed up 19% from its $135 offer price, reaching $160.95.
